The Ontario Belgian Horse Association and Ontario Clydesdale Club banquet was held on February 8th in Tavistock. The banquet was a huge success, well organized and attended. The banquet wrapped up during a snow storm! Thank you to the banquet committee and everyone that braved the weather.
During the banquet we heard speeches from our two Ontario Clydesdale Club ambassador applicants. These two ladies are both worthy of the position, but the ambassador committee was only allowed to select 1. Congratulations to Rowan Timmons, our 2025 Ontario Clydesdale Club ambassador. The new Youth Showmanship Program was a success in 2024! The program is expanding and will include a Youth Cart Class in 2025. The Youth Program Online Auction will be returning this year in May/June. Please follow our Facebook page for this event and bid, bid, bid!!!
It’s time to get your Ontario Bred & Sired Yearling Stallion or Mare registered for the 2025 show season. The following are the qualifying shows for 2025: Essa, Navan, Paisley, Forest, The Royal,
Lindsay, Simcoe and The Triple Crown. Please register before July 1 st.

Time is ticking to get your Ontario Bred & Sired Yearling Stallion or Mare registered for the 2025 show season. The following are the qualifying shows for 2025: Essa, Navan, Paisley, Forest, The Royal, Lindsay, Simcoe and The Triple Crown. Please register before August 1st.
John Hooke, Heather Frank and Leah Everson are planning the 2025 OCC Golf Tournament to be held on July 12 , 2025, at the Maitland Links Golf Club. For anyone interested in participating via Hole Sponsorship, Prize donation, a round of golf or just to join the golfers for dinner, please reach out to John Hooke at john.hooke@cantire.ca.
